ALUCOM AG, headquartered in Ludwigshafen am Rhein, offers its customers solutions for the chemical industry, paper, and water treatment based on its own aluminum compounds. The construction industry also benefits from specialized aluminum compounds.

We are among the largest producers of aluminum compounds such as inorganic precipitants, setting accelerators, special aluminum hydroxides, polyaluminum chlorides (such as PAC and ACH), aluminum sulfates, aluminum formates, and sodium aluminates, as well as mixtures e.g. with iron salts and polymers.

History / Production Site

Ausgewähltes Bild
  • 1823: Paul Giulini, together with his brother Johann-Baptist Giulini, founds the “Schwefelsäurefabrik Wohlgelegen” sulfuric acid plant in Mannheim. After internal disputes, it was renamed “Gebrüder Giulini”.
  • 1851: New construction of the plant in Ludwigshafen (sulfuric acid, soda using the Le Blanc process…)
  • 1865: Commencement of alumina production using French bauxite. Use of pyrite for sulfuric acid production.
  • 1893: Relocation of the production facility to its current location in Ludwigshafen Mundenheim. Expansion to include fertilizers and phosphate salts, focusing on aluminum and aluminum compounds.
    Georg Giulini (le roi d‘alumine) expands and develops the plant in Ludwigshafen
    (Pyrogen process, further development of the Bayer process…). After the Second World War, construction of an aluminum smelter.
  • 1977: ICL takes over the aluminum salts, phosphate salts, fertilizers, and gypsum divisions, Alcoa the aluminum hydroxides and oxides division, and ALCAN the aluminum smelter.
  • 2015: Kurita Europe takes over the aluminum salts, polymers, paper chemicals, and water treatment chemicals divisions from ICL.
  • 2018: LIVIA Group takes over the aluminum salts division on 01.10.2018: → new company name: ALUCOM AG.
  • 2025: The VTA Group takes over ALUCOM AG.
